Поделиться через


Интерфейс ITAgentEvent (tapi3.h)

Интерфейс ITAgentEvent содержит методы, которые извлекают описание событий агента. Если реализация приложения метода ITTAPIEventNotification::Event указывает TAPI_EVENTравное TE_AGENT, параметр pEvent метода является указателем IDispatch для интерфейса ITAgentEvent . Методы этого интерфейса можно использовать для получения сведений о произошедшем событии агента.

Дополнительные сведения об агентах см. в разделе Об элементах управления Центра обработки вызовов .

Примечание Необходимо вызвать метод ITTAPI::p ut_EventFilter и задать маску фильтра событий, включающую событие TE_AGENT , чтобы включить прием событий агента. Если вы не вызываете ITTAPI::p ut_EventFilter, приложение не будет получать никаких событий. Дополнительные сведения см. в обзоре событий .
 

Наследование

Интерфейс ITAgentEvent наследуется от интерфейса IDispatch . ITAgentEvent также имеет следующие типы элементов:

Методы

Интерфейс ITAgentEvent содержит следующие методы.

 
ITAgentEvent::get_Agent

Метод ITAgentEvent::get_Agent (tapi3.h) получает интерфейс агента, в котором произошло событие.
ITAgentEvent::get_Event

Метод ITAgentEvent::get_Event (tapi3.h) получает AGENT_EVENT дескриптор произошедшего события.

Требования

Требование Значение
Целевая платформа Windows
Header tapi3.h (включая Tapi3.h)

См. также раздел

AGENT_EVENT

Сведения об элементах управления Центра обработки вызовов

IDispatch

ITAgent

ITTAPIEventNotification::Event

Фрагмент кода регистрации событий

TAPI_EVENT